TICKET-4412: Sheetforge export workers OOM on staging. Cause: staging env was cloned from the demo box, so the export pool size and cache limits are wrong for large spreadsheets. Fix: replace staging `.env` with the template in `ops/templates`, bump worker memory to 2G. While re-creating the file, the export signing credential must be set on this line:

sealed setting: RELAY_SECRET13=bca49b02a6971

Ticket: Config drift on cachefront-prod (Quillback team). During the stale-cache postmortem we found the TTL overrides on nodes 3–7 no longer match the committed baseline; someone hand-patched them during the March incident and never reverted. This explains the serving of week-old pricing pages. Drift needs reconciling before Friday's deploy freeze. For reference at the sync, the current live values are below.

service settings:
[silwyn]
host = silwyn.crelvogrid.internal
user = silwyn_svc
database = silwyn_prod

Hi Marit,

Welcome to the Gatewright on-call rotation. Quick notes on rate limiting: limits are per-tenant, enforced at the edge tier, config reloads every 60s. If a tenant pages you about 429s, check burst allowance before touching anything. Never raise global limits during an incident without a second approver. Escalation paths and the override procedure are documented on the internal page here.

runbook for kadug-tadug: https://confluence.zemvarlabs.internal/pages/projects/pages/display

# Training Budget FY Next — Managers Only

Board summary: Varnell Group proposes a 12% increase in the training allocation, concentrated on the Kestrel certification track and leadership rotations at the Dunmore site. Headcount growth in the Analytics division drives most of the uplift. External vendor spend stays flat; internal delivery expands. Approval requested at the December session. Unspent funds will not roll over. Full line items sit in the restricted finance workspace. The allocation also supports the plans outlined below.

internal memo for hahif-hahaf: Headcount on the Zorwyn team goes from 9 to 100 by the end of October. Gross margin on Zorwyn came in at 5 percent against a plan of 10 percent.